您好!用TB开拓者实现期货自动交易,核心步骤包括策略编写、回测验证、参数优化、实盘绑定及风控配置。新手建议通过正规证券公司开通TB开拓者权限,其优势在于合规性高、数据接口稳定且支持官方技术团队答疑;也可网上联系专业客户经理,能获取从策略编写到实盘运行的一对一指导,降低试错成本。
《TB开拓者期货自动交易全流程指南》
语言选择:TB开拓者采用麦语言(WHL),类似“搭积木”式编程。例如,写一个简单的“均线金叉死叉”策略:
whl// 定义参数 PARAMS: SHORT_MA(5), LONG_MA(20); // 信号触发条件 BUY: CROSS(MA(CLOSE, SHORT_MA), MA(CLOSE, LONG_MA)); SELL: CROSS(MA(CLOSE, LONG_MA), MA(CLOSE, SHORT_MA));
逻辑扩展:可叠加技术指标(如MACD、RSI)或资金管理规则(如固定仓位、动态止损)。例如,当RSI突破70且MACD红柱缩短时,强制平仓以控制风险。
回测验证与参数调优
数据导入:在TB开拓者“模型测试”模块中,选择目标期货品种(如螺纹钢、沪铜)的历史K线数据(建议覆盖牛熊周期)。
参数优化:通过“网格搜索”功能,对均线周期、止损比例等参数进行组合测试。例如,将SHORT_MA从3-10、LONG_MA从15-30进行遍历,筛选出夏普比率最高(>1.5)、最大回撤低(<20%)的组合。
实盘绑定与风控配置
账户授权:在TB开拓者“自动交易”模块中,绑定期货公司交易账号(需提前开通程序化交易权限)。
风控规则:设置最大持仓手数(如单品种不超过总资金10%)、动态止损(如亏损达总资金2%时平仓)、滑点容差(如市价单允许±1跳价差),避免极端行情下策略失控。
若想系统学习TB开拓者策略开发,可预约我领取《TB开拓者期货量化交易指南》及现成的日内波段、跨品种套利策略模板(含详细注释与参数优化建议)。无论是新手入门还是策略进阶,我都将为你提供从理论到实操的全程支持,助你高效搭建自动交易体系!
发布于2025-4-26 11:11 北京

